Transaction 75df728effccfb4d32e76937c94e0624eb426b1da1e423a9d5f642490ce7199b

2 Input
2 Outputs
  • 75df728effccfb4d32e76937c94e0624eb426b1da1e423a9d5f642490ce7199b:0
  • value  1662911
    address  3Hu3Qcq1krzwK9ufMPzi4y1YveLvwgEvWa
  • 75df728effccfb4d32e76937c94e0624eb426b1da1e423a9d5f642490ce7199b:1
  • value  332860
    address  3DeNrEzKoUdDa6m3FJvp4jPBk1JrUfuUHz